Tropicana: Tropicana, a paradise under the stars
  • Tip Rating:
  • The Tropicana Cabaret is Cuba's most famous cabaret. Opened in 1931, it's known as the "Paradise under the Stars" and it has been pleasing crowds ever since. Surrounded by lush vegetation visits can enjoy a glittering spectacle featuring over 200 singers, dancers, musicians and vocalists.

    Tickets can be ordered by phone from 10am – 6pm or buy them at the ticket booth at 8:30 pm (call ahead of time to check availability) reservations can be made through any travel agency desk located in most of the hotels.

    Some different daily offers U can choose from to enjoy the show:
    - 1rst offer
    1/4 Botella de Ron (3 years Old)
    1 Refresco.
    1 Botella pequeña de vino Freixenet.
    70 cuc/pax

    - 2nd offer:
    1/4 Botella de Ron (5 years Old)
    1 Refresco.
    1 Botella pequeña de vino Freixenet.
    1 Hors D’oeuvre.
    Table close to the scenary
    80 cuc/pax.

    - 3rd offer
    1/4 Botella de Ron (5 years Old o Whisky)
    1 Refresco.
    1 Botella pequeña de vino Freixenet.
    1 Hors D’oeuvre.
    1 fotografía
    90 cuc/pax.

    To include dinner with the reservation, 10cuc more per person.

    No shorts, no sneakers, no sandals

    Tropicana: "Paradise under the skies"
  • Tip Rating:
  • It's spectacular and expensive (we paid 75 USD each and got a cola, 0.5 l rum, tapas and a little bottle of sparkling wine). I'm happy I've seen it, but once is enough.
    It's possible to have dinner before the show in an elegant restaurant with live piano music. The food is nothing special, as usually.
    The picture is from http://www.cubacom.net/tropicana/, as I didn't take my camera to the club (I was sorry afterwards - it is allowed to take photos, but only with a permit).

    I don't know if there are any rules (probably no jeans and shorts), but most people were fairly elegant.

    Tropicana: Tropicana - Superb entertainment
  • Tip Rating:
  • Even though the Tropicana cabaret is a bit pricy it’s worth every convertible pesos.

    The dancers, the dresses and the live music all make you just sit back and enjoy the atmosphere at the outdoor scene that is converted to a dance floor for the audience after the show.

    I had a ringside seat and almost had to duck when the skirts were whirling :-)

    If you want to take pictures it’s an extra 5 CUC.
    You can see more of my pictures from Tropicana at http://cuba.atheart.dk

    If you want to take video it’s an extra 15 CUC.

    My recipe for the camera was checked twice. Just keep it in you shirt pocket and the whole deal of showing it is a 3 second thing - no need to take your eyes off the show!

    The fantasies in the show can challenge everyone. When my 7 year old nephew saw my pictures he was totally amused: “She’s dancing with a chandelier on her head. It’s lit, and it hasn’t even fallen from the ceiling? :-)
